Iranian drone strikes shut down Qatar LNG production facilities, as energy prices surge
- Iranian drone strikes forced Qatar to halt LNG production at two facilities, disrupting global energy markets.
- QatarEnergy suspended operations at two facilities after drones hit sites in the country, with no casualties reported.
- The Ras Laffan complex, a major LNG export hub, and another facility near Mesaieed were targeted.
- Global LNG markets reacted with price increases as markets assessed the disruption’s duration.
- Energy hub security in the Gulf region faces heightened risk as tensions rise.
- Qatar’s defense ministry confirmed drones hit facilities but reported no casualties.
- The incident adds to regional instability affecting energy supply chains.
- European and Asian LNG prices rose as traders assessed the disruption’s length.
- Saudi Arabia also faced a separate drone incident at Ras Tanura refinery.
